Scheduling agmt v/s Source list validity dates

Former Member
0 Kudos

Hi,

When the MRP runs it is considering the Source list validity even if the Scheduling agreement is invalid. Can you please advice if this is standard SAP behavior and if there exist any configuration to control this ?

MRP does not search through the schedule agreements.

MRP looks into the source list, it checks if the source list item has a MRP indicator 2

and is valid at the requirements date.

Only if this is positive the schedule agreement number can be known and taken.

The Scheduling agreement validity date is Invalid. But the source list's validity date is Valid for this Scheduling agreement with MRP ind as "2".

MRP is generating the schedule lines for the expired SA as the source list's Validity is valid.

Just wanted to confirm if there is any config driving this or this is just standard SAP behavior.

Please observe that MRP checks the validity according to the requirement date. This is stated on point 2 of the mentioned document. Therefore, check on transaction MD05 is there is any rescheduling message for this scheduling agreement with a date where it is still valid. It means that the scheduling agreement was created for a requirement on this date.
